What nail color rejuvenates hands? Meet the best shades of hybrid polish!

As we age, the skin on our hands loses its firmness, and discoloration and wrinkles become more visible. The wrong gel polish shade can unfortunately highlight these imperfections even more. But is there a trendy nail color that visually rejuvenates the hands? Absolutely! All you need is the right gel polish – one that adds freshness, a natural glow, and gives your hands a visibly younger look.

Nail colors that visually rejuvenate your hands

Not every nail polish shade works in favor of your hands. Some colors can highlight dry cuticles, skin unevenness or visible veins. Which trendy nail colors should you choose to achieve the desired rejuvenating effect?

1. Soft pinks – natural elegance

Nail shades that mimic the natural color of your nails, like powder pink, peach beige, or milky pink, are an absolute must-have for women who want to bring freshness and lightness to their hands. Soft pastel gel polish shades work like a "highlighter" for your skin, making it look rested, healthy, and glowing.

2. Classic red – a timeless choice

A red manicure is the epitome of elegance and luxury, but it’s worth choosing warmer undertones like coral, raspberry, poppy red, or fiery red with a touch of orange. Shades that are too cool or too dark can give your hands a harsh look, emphasizing tiredness and taking away their glow and freshness.

3. Pastel nail colors – freshness and youthful glow

Pastel gel polishes are a perfect choice for women who want to bring softness, freshness, and radiance to their hands. Shades like faded pink, juicy peach, apricot, pistachio, or light coral have the power to brighten and visually rejuvenate the skin, making your hands look well-rested and full of life. Pastels act like a natural smoothing filter – minimizing the appearance of fine lines, discoloration, and uneven skin tone while giving your skin a healthy, even glow.

4. Beiges and nudes – timeless and foolproof

Light nude shades matched to your skin tone are timelessly elegant and complement every complexion. Warm beiges and creamy tones create the effect of well-groomed hands and make the skin appear smoother. Additionally, these nail colors visually elongate and slim the fingers.

5. Pearly and milky whites – subtle rejuvenation

White might seem like a risky choice, but alternatives like milky white, pearly tones, and delicate French manicure are timeless classics that add freshness and lightness to the hands. Matte white can emphasize imperfections, so opt for gel polishes with a subtle shimmer or satin finish.

Which nail colors make your hands look older? Avoid these shades!

While trendy nail polish colors help you stay up-to-date with the latest manicure trends, some hybrid polish shades can visually age your hands. If you care about keeping your hands looking youthful, it's worth consciously avoiding shades that emphasize skin imperfections, discoloration, or visible veins.

1. Very dark polishes

Black, deep brown, navy blue, plum, or dark green are all very elegant shades, but they can also give your hands a harsh and cold appearance. Dark colors contrast strongly with the skin, which often makes discoloration, wrinkles, or unevenness more noticeable. If you love deep colors, go for warmer tones – for example, choose graphite with a subtle shine instead of pure black, or a warm burgundy with a touch of red instead of dark plum.

2. Overly cool and bluish shades

Colors with cool, grayish, or bluish undertones – like lavender purple, steel blue, or muted gray – can negatively impact how the skin on your hands looks. Cool hues highlight visible veins and make your skin look tired and dull. If you like pastels, go for warm pinks, beiges, or peach tones that brighten your hands and make them look fresh.

3. Bright neon polishes

Neon nail colors such as lemon yellow, neon pink, or bright lime are energetic and modern, but unfortunately don’t always enhance the appearance of your hands. These colors create strong contrast with the skin and may draw unwanted attention to imperfections like dry skin or discoloration. If you're going for bold, it's better to choose warm shades of red, coral, or raspberry pink that add a youthful glow to your hands.

4. Matte finish

Matte polishes are super trendy, but they can emphasize dryness and fine lines on the skin, especially when used in very dark or very light shades. A matte finish absorbs light, which can make hands look tired and lifeless. Instead, go for a subtle shine, satin finish, or delicate shimmer that beautifully reflects light and makes your hands look fresh and radiant.

Choose a nail color that enhances your beauty!

Your hands deserve to look fresh, radiant, and elegant. By choosing warm shades of pink, peachy pastels, classic reds, or soft beiges, you can visually rejuvenate your hands and give them a healthy, well-groomed look. Avoid shades that highlight skin imperfections – instead of cool, muted tones, go for nail polish colors that add lightness and a soft glow to your hands.

Remember, beauty is in the details – the perfect hybrid polish color is just part of the equation. Regular hand care, moisturized skin, and maintaining nail health will ensure your manicure always looks flawless.
